Long time lurker, finally decided to join. I purchased this truck for $500 about a year ago and it has been my project since then. 92 GMC C1500, 200K miles, 4.3, AT. I forget the trim package but I would say W/T. I still have a long way to go, especially compared to some of these impressive builds.

Looking forward to learning and getting even more ideas from everyone.

Ordered a new rocker, and the rest I cut out a floor from the junkyard and welded it all in. Bottom of the driver's door also had rust, so I found another one rust free.

Interior was shot, the dash was completely disintegrated. It took a long time to find a decent replacement seat, dash and carpet. Kept a seat cover on until I found another bench.

I didn't really like the original GMC grill, so I tried a 94+ and wasn't thrilled with it either. I wanted to keep the classic look so I went with the older Chevy grill and that is what l have kept on it.
